Exploring the Potential of 4-Dodecylaniline in Advanced Material Science
The field of material science is constantly seeking novel compounds that can impart unique properties to materials. 4-Dodecylaniline, a versatile aromatic amine with a significant alkyl chain, is emerging as a key player in several advanced material applications. Its chemical structure, combining a polar aniline head with a long, non-polar dodecyl tail, grants it amphiphilic characteristics that are invaluable in creating specialized materials and enhancing existing ones.
One significant area of exploration for 4-Dodecylaniline is in the realm of nanomaterial dispersion. Single-walled carbon nanotubes (SWNTs), for instance, are known for their exceptional mechanical and electrical properties but suffer from poor solubility in common solvents, hindering their widespread application. 4-Dodecylaniline acts as a surfactant, effectively adsorbing onto the surface of SWNTs and increasing their compatibility with aqueous or other polar media. This improved dispersion capability opens doors for the use of SWNTs in advanced composites, conductive inks, and even biomedical applications like targeted drug delivery systems. Furthermore, the compound's structure lends itself to applications in liquid crystal materials. The long alkyl chain can influence the mesophase behavior and ordering of liquid crystal molecules, potentially leading to enhanced electro-optical performance in displays and other photonic devices. Another promising application is in corrosion inhibition. Derivatives of 4-Dodecylaniline have demonstrated significant efficacy in protecting metal surfaces, such as copper, from corrosive environments. These compounds form protective films through adsorption, leveraging their amphiphilic nature to create a barrier against aggressive species. This makes them attractive candidates for use in protective coatings and in industrial processes where metal integrity is critical.
